The Sorrows of Young Werther German Die Leiden des jungen Werthers is a 1774 epistolary novel by Johann Wolfgang Goethe which appeared as a revised edition in 1787 It was one of the main novels in the Sturm und Drang period in German literature and influenced the later Romantic movement Goethe aged 24 at the time finished Werther in five and a half weeks of intensive writing in January to March 1774 It instantly placed him among the foremost international literary celebrities and was among the best known of his works The novel is made up of biographical and auto biographical facts in relation to two triangular relationships and one individual
